Overview

The systemic plasma protein milieu refers to the complex and dynamic collection of proteins, cytokines, and signaling molecules circulating in the blood. This proteome acts as a functional snapshot of an organism's health, facilitating communication between distant organs and maintaining physiological homeostasis (Nature Medicine, 2019). In the context of aging research, the milieu has gained prominence due to studies showing that young plasma can rejuvenate aged tissues, while old plasma can induce senescence in young organisms (Nature, 2014). Therapeutic strategies targeting the milieu, such as therapeutic plasma exchange (TPE) or neutral blood exchange, aim to dilute accumulated pro-aging factors and inflammatory cytokines to promote systemic repair and reduce the burden of age-related diseases (Aging, 2020). Because it encompasses thousands of distinct proteins, it is considered a system-level environment rather than a discrete molecular target.

Mechanism of action

Modulation of the systemic environment through the removal of pro-inflammatory or pro-aging factors (e.g., via plasma dilution or exchange) and the potential replenishment of youthful or protective factors to restore tissue homeostasis.
